By Battery Type Zinc-Air Batteries Still the dominant format in 2024, thanks to their high energy density, compact size, and affordability. They are sold in standard sizes (10, 13, 312, 675) tailored to different hearing aid models. Zinc-air accounts for nearly 65% of market share in 2024 but is gradually losing ground to rechargeable formats. Rechargeable Lithium-Ion Batteries The fastest-growing segment, with adoption driven by the elimination of frequent battery changes, especially appealing for elderly users with dexterity challenges. Major hearing aid OEMs are now designing new devices around integrated rechargeable cells. By Hearing Aid Type Behind-the-Ear (BTE) and Receiver-in-Canal (RIC) These account for the largest demand for batteries, given their higher adoption among elderly users and longer battery requirements. In-the-Ear (ITE) and Completely-in-Canal (CIC) Smaller devices that require smaller, short-life zinc-air batteries, though many are transitioning toward rechargeable designs. Market Trends And Innovation Landscape The hearing aid batteries market is in the middle of a technology transition. Disposable zinc-air cells remain the standard, but innovations in rechargeable chemistry, smart charging, and sustainability are setting the tone for what the next generation of hearing aid power systems will look like. Shift Toward Rechargeables The most visible trend is the rapid rise of lithium-ion rechargeable batteries . Instead of replacing batteries every few days, users can now dock their hearing aids overnight — similar to smartphones. This shift solves a key pain point for elderly patients: manual battery handling. One audiologist put it bluntly: “Every patient over 70 asks me if they can avoid fiddling with tiny batteries.” As more hearing aid OEMs integrate sealed lithium-ion cells, the share of disposable zinc-air is expected to fall steadily. Smart Charging Ecosystems Manufacturers are going beyond just rechargeable cells. Charging docks with wireless induction technology , portable charging cases, and even solar-powered accessories are emerging. Some high-end hearing aids now feature “quick charge” modes that deliver several hours of use from just 15 minutes of charging. For users who travel frequently or live in regions with unstable electricity, portable charging kits are becoming a differentiator. Environmental Push and Regulation Disposables have environmental baggage. Zinc-air batteries contain metals that can accumulate in landfills. With governments in the EU pushing hard on single-use battery reduction , suppliers are investing in recyclable chemistries and take-back programs. In fact, several European audiology clinics now offer drop-off bins for used cells, often tied to OEM recycling initiatives. Chemistry Innovation While lithium-ion leads the charge, research is also exploring solid-state microbatteries and zinc-based rechargeable chemistries to balance cost, safety, and size. These technologies are not mainstream yet, but prototypes are showing promise for higher cycle life and smaller form factors, which could be crucial for canal-type hearing aids. Integration with Connectivity Modern hearing aids are no longer passive amplifiers. Bluetooth streaming, AI-based noise filtering, and smartphone connectivity require higher power stability. This means batteries must handle bursty energy demands without draining too quickly. Vendors are investing in high-drain optimized cells that can support wireless streaming for longer hours. Partnerships Driving Change The innovation landscape is also shaped by collaborations: Battery makers partnering with hearing aid OEMs to co-develop rechargeable modules. Tech companies exploring wireless power transfer for medical wearables, with hearing aids as a potential test case. Sustainability alliances pushing for closed-loop recycling of button cells. Competitive Intelligence And Benchmarking Unlike general consumer batteries, the hearing aid batteries market is controlled by a small set of specialized players. Success here isn’t just about price — it’s about chemistry expertise, partnerships with hearing aid OEMs, and building trust with an aging user base. Key Players Energizer Holdings Long-time leader in zinc-air hearing aid batteries, Energizer dominates global retail channels. The company focuses on broad availability and brand trust, making it the go-to option in pharmacies and hearing clinics. Its strength lies in volume sales and a reliable supply chain. Duracell (Berkshire Hathaway) Known for premium positioning, Duracell leverages strong retail presence and partnerships with audiology professionals. Its product lines emphasize long shelf-life and consistent discharge performance. Duracell is investing in rechargeable R&D, though its disposable batteries remain a bigger revenue stream. Rayovac (part of Energizer Group) Marketed as a specialist brand, Rayovac supplies zinc-air batteries directly to hearing aid manufacturers as well as retail. Its “extra-long life” and “high-drain optimized” products target users with Bluetooth-enabled devices. Panasonic Corporation While not as dominant in the West, Panasonic has carved out a strong presence in Asia-Pacific. Its batteries are widely distributed through retail and hearing aid clinics, especially in Japan and China. Panasonic also invests in sustainable battery chemistries to align with regional regulations. VARTA AG A German company that plays a dual role: supplying OEMs with microbattery solutions and selling under its own brand. VARTA is one of the strongest innovators in rechargeable lithium-ion technology for hearing aids, giving it an edge as the market shifts away from disposables. ZPower (Rechargeable Specialist) A niche but disruptive player, ZPower focuses exclusively on rechargeable silver-zinc technology. While it struggled with early adoption issues, it represents a key attempt to diversify beyond lithium-ion and zinc-air chemistry. Competitive Benchmarking Zinc-Air Market Leaders : Energizer, Rayovac, and Duracell dominate here, controlling a majority of global disposable sales. Their advantage lies in brand recognition and global retail coverage. Rechargeable Innovators : VARTA and ZPower stand out. VARTA’s lithium-ion solutions are integrated into many premium hearing aids, while ZPower represents a different technological path with its silver-zinc approach. Regional Strongholds : Panasonic in Asia and VARTA in Europe highlight how regional preferences and regulations shape competition. OEM Integration as a Differentiator : Players aligned with hearing aid manufacturers (e.g., Sonova or Demant partnerships) hold a long-term advantage, since end-users often stick with whatever battery system their device requires. Regional Landscape And Adoption Outlook Regional adoption of hearing aid batteries isn’t uniform. It reflects how health systems treat hearing care, how consumers access hearing aids, and how quickly each region is moving toward rechargeable formats. North America This is one of the most mature markets for hearing aids, and by extension, batteries. High hearing aid penetration rates, insurance reimbursement in certain states, and strong audiology networks drive consistent demand. Rechargeables are gaining traction quickly, especially in the U.S. where device makers like Sonova and GN Store Nord are rolling out lithium-ion powered models. Disposable zinc-air still holds a notable share, particularly among older users resistant to new technology. Retail channels (pharmacies, Costco, Walgreens) dominate sales, but online subscription services for replacement batteries are expanding. Europe Europe has a regulatory-driven market . The EU’s push for sustainability and waste reduction is accelerating the decline of disposable zinc-air batteries. Countries like Germany and Scandinavia are leading adoption of rechargeable hearing aids. Southern and Eastern Europe, with less purchasing power, still rely more on disposable formats. National healthcare systems often subsidize hearing aids, indirectly shaping battery choices — clinics increasingly recommend rechargeable devices to lower lifetime costs. Asia Pacific The fastest-growing region , thanks to rapid aging populations and expanding healthcare access. Japan is already advanced in hearing aid adoption, with rechargeable models finding strong acceptance among tech-savvy seniors. China and India represent the biggest growth opportunities. Awareness campaigns and government programs to support elderly care are pushing demand, though rural areas still prefer cheaper zinc-air batteries. South Korea and Australia are mid-sized but important markets, with high uptake of Bluetooth-enabled devices that require high-drain optimized batteries. Latin America A developing but underpenetrated market. Brazil and Mexico lead in hearing aid adoption, supported by urban middle-class populations. Disposable zinc-air batteries dominate due to affordability. Rechargeables are present but remain a niche choice, constrained by price and limited service networks. Public-private health partnerships are starting to improve access, but coverage remains inconsistent across the region. Middle East & Africa (MEA) This remains the least developed market , but not without opportunity. In wealthier Gulf states like Saudi Arabia and the UAE , rechargeable batteries are becoming standard as premium hearing aids gain adoption. In most of Africa, hearing aid penetration is extremely low, and battery availability is often a barrier. NGOs and health charities play a large role in distribution. The lack of consistent electricity infrastructure in some regions means zinc-air batteries are likely to remain relevant longer than in developed markets. End-User Dynamics And Use Case End users in the hearing aid battery market aren’t just individuals. The value chain runs through audiologists, retailers, clinics, and caregivers — each with different expectations and levels of influence over battery choice. Key End-User Groups Individual Consumers (Elderly Users) This is the largest end-user group. Most elderly patients prefer familiarity, which is why zinc-air batteries remain dominant among long-time hearing aid users. The convenience of walking into a pharmacy and buying a pack still outweighs the appeal of rechargeables for some. That said, dexterity issues and the hassle of frequent replacements are accelerating interest in rechargeable devices among new adopters. Audiology Clinics and Hearing Care Professionals Audiologists strongly influence patient choices. In North America and Europe, many now recommend rechargeable devices as the default option, framing them as safer, more convenient, and eco-friendly. Clinics often maintain in-house stock of zinc-air batteries for legacy users while promoting rechargeable upgrades to new patients. Retail Pharmacies and Specialty Stores Pharmacies remain the most common distribution channel, especially for zinc-air batteries. Large chains (e.g., CVS, Boots, Watsons) hold significant market power because they control product placement and pricing. Specialty hearing aid retailers also offer bundled services, such as battery replacement programs. E-Commerce Platforms Online sales are gaining traction across all regions, particularly for repeat purchases. Subscription services for zinc-air batteries and bundled packages of chargers plus batteries are popular with caregivers ordering for elderly relatives. Hospitals and Rehabilitation Centers While not direct consumers, hospitals play a role in recommending specific brands during hearing aid fittings or rehabilitation sessions. Some even offer “starter kits” including batteries when new patients receive devices. Use Case Highlight A mid-sized audiology clinic in Berlin, Germany recently shifted its recommendations from zinc-air to rechargeable lithium-ion hearing aids. The clinic noticed that elderly patients frequently returned with complaints about difficulty handling small batteries and running out of replacements unexpectedly. After introducing a program where every new patient received a rechargeable model bundled with a portable charging dock, the clinic saw: A 30% drop in follow-up complaints related to battery issues within six months. Higher satisfaction among patients with mild dementia, since caregivers no longer had to manage frequent replacements. Reduced clinic costs, since staff spent less time troubleshooting battery-related problems. The lesson is clear: when end-user pain points are addressed, adoption shifts rapidly.
